“You're not normal, not right. You're not my son.”
You're not wrong, not quite, but just this once.
“You're strange, you're weird, you're going to lose.”
You, once revered, yourself recuse.
“You're just like her: no life, no lies.”
But he is lost who does not try.
“You're just a kid with bright ideas.”
But he is deaf who does not hear.
“You're gonna get your ass kicked if you want the world to change.”
But first I'll quell this tyranny of what the world thinks strange.
“You think you know the answers - “ And the answer's what I seek -
“but I wish you wouldn't question.” 'Cause I know it makes you weak.
“You're never gonna make it - “ And I feel your errant woe -
“ - when you don't respect the ancient.” - and with that, I've gotta go.
